How to invest in yourself?

Siemanko.

What ways do you know how to invest in yourself? I am currently studying and learning foreign languages (Spanish and English). How could I still develop, preferably for free?

It depends on the amounts at your disposal. In my opinion, small amounts are best invested in your education. Do a course in the industry that interests you, buy a good book or e-book. There is so much knowledge on the Internet that you will run out of life to absorb it, so selection is necessary. If you take care of your development in some field, you will become a more valued employee or contractor, and this should translate into an increase in remuneration in the future. Maybe you dare to change your job or start a business? Or will you become a valued expert? At worst, you'll just be… smarter. And if you have more money at your disposal, travel the world as much as possible while still possible. Nothing develops as much as contact with completely different cultures and people.

My advice is not to limit yourself to studies only, because it can be different. Sometimes the fascination with a given field passes as you get to know it more deeply, and by the end of your studies you already know that you will want to do something completely different in your life. I am an example of such a man :) It is worth making a few "professional gates", i.e. learning in various fields and - what is important - collecting some documents for everything (certificates, references). Then it will be much easier for you to find a job in the future, and the employer will certainly appreciate that you are an ambitious and versatile person. I recommend, for example, training organized by PAED (https://www.parp.gov.pl/component/site/site/kursy-online) or by Startup Booster (https://startupbooster.pl/szkolenia/). They are all free and online, and PAED issues certificates later. Mostly, these are trainings on how to run a business or trainings developing soft skills, which are in fact useful everywhere. This is a bit of investing in yourself and your skills. But you're doing the right thing by learning languages too.

If I were you, I would invest in health, and then in skills that can be useful in your industry and bring you profits in the future. I don't know what you do on a daily basis, so it's hard for me to advise you in more detail. If for the time being your only occupation is studies, then the range of possibilities is practically unlimited. Nevertheless, I would put health first, because it will pay off in the future. You can join any sports club as part of developing a hobby and keeping fit. By the way, you will meet interesting people from outside the university. Movement in the fresh air also has a very good effect on the activity and efficiency of our mind. Also, take care of your appearance, because when they see you, that's how they write you. You may unexpectedly be offered a job because someone finds you fit to represent their company or meet future colleagues. Pay special attention to teeth - although Poland is not as obsessed with them as in the USA, a beautiful smile opens many doors. In addition, dental services will become more and more expensive over the years. Unfortunately, recently I found out for myself how much it costs a general dentition repair and crown insertion.
